Runbook 4.2 — Returned Demo Units

When demo units come back from the Orvath Showroom circuit, dispatch logs each serial against the outbound manifest and flags any missing accessories. Units are wiped by the bench team within 24 hours, then staged on Rack D pending redeployment or return to Fennick Instruments. If a unit is recalled by the vendor, a bonded courier collects it directly from Rack D. For all vendor-recall collections, dispatch must follow the confidential hand-over instruction stated below:

handover note for yagef-bagep: the drudor pelius courier leaves the kasdor zorvan norir ledger at gate 8016 under passcode 755406

Action item: The Relayn deploy-status bot silently dropped updates when the pipeline API paginated results, so responders believed a rollback had completed when it had not. We will add pagination handling, a staleness banner, and an integration test. Until merged, verify deploy state directly in the pipeline console, documented at the page below.

runbook for kahop-kajop: https://rundeck.ordinio.test/display/secrets/pipeline/issue/pages/repo/browse/e5732776e07d1285107e5aeb

# DeployDrake Environments

DeployDrake, our deploy-status chat bot, runs in three environments: sandbox, staging, and production. Each environment polls a separate pipeline feed and posts to its own channel, so reviewers can test message formatting without noise in production. Behavior differences are driven entirely by configuration. The staging environment currently runs with these values.

service settings:
[casax]
port = 6379
team = rusir
host = casax.zemvarhq.corp
region = outer-4
access_code = ac_9808ce
timeout_ms = 1500

## Bannerline Environments

New folks, read this first. Bannerline (our consent banner service) runs in dev, preview, and prod. Dev shows the banner on every load so you can test variants quickly. Preview matches prod's region rules — important, since consent requirements differ per region and we rolled out gradually. Prod changes need a sign-off from the privacy channel, no exceptions. The preview environment currently runs with these values.

deployment values, kajep-kageg:
[praix]
host = praix.paliqcorp.corp
user = praix_svc
database = praix_prod